-
- mysql如何处理复制中断
- 答案:MySQL复制中断需快速定位原因并恢复一致性。首先通过SHOWSLAVESTATUS\G检查Slave_IO_Running、Slave_SQL_Running、Last_Error和Seconds_Behind_Master状态,判断问题类型。常见原因包括主库binlog被清理、主键冲突、网络不稳定或server-id重复。针对不同情况采取重搭从库、跳过错误、调整网络参数或修正配置等措施。修复后执行STARTSLAVE并监控延迟至正常。数据差异大时建议用XtraBackup重建。预防方面
- 每日编程 855 2025-09-18 08:16:02
-
- mysql如何限制用户访问列
- 答案:MySQL不支持直接列级权限,可通过视图限制列访问,如创建仅含id和name的users_public视图并授予权限;也可使用列级GRANT语句限制SELECT或UPDATE特定列;还可通过应用层控制查询字段或使用存储过程封装数据访问,推荐结合视图与权限控制实现安全隔离。
- 每日编程 730 2025-09-18 08:13:01
-
- css颜色在表单控件中的应用技巧
- 答案是通过合理运用CSS颜色,可显著提升表单的用户体验与可访问性。具体包括:为不同控件状态(默认、聚焦、错误、成功等)设置高对比度的颜色以符合WCAG标准;使用语义化颜色(如红表错误、绿表成功)直观传达状态;通过CSS变量统一管理主题色,便于维护与深色模式适配;结合:valid/:invalid伪类与JavaScript实现即时验证反馈;避免滥用!important和过度样式化,确保跨浏览器一致性,并在多设备上充分测试,从而实现功能与美学兼具的表单交互设计。
- 每日编程 868 2025-09-18 08:04:01
-
- css选择器在动画和过渡中的作用
- CSS选择器决定动画或过渡作用的元素,如类、ID选择器精准绑定效果,伪类响应交互状态,组合选择器控制触发条件,实现高效流畅的视觉交互。
- 每日编程 1031 2025-09-18 08:01:01
-
- PHP如何获取类的所有方法_PHP反射获取类方法列表
- 使用ReflectionClass的getMethods()可获取类的所有方法,结合位掩码筛选特定权限或特性方法,适用于ORM、依赖注入等动态场景。
- 每日编程 826 2025-09-18 08:00:03
-
- PHP如何实现简单搜索功能_搜索功能开发详细步骤
- PHP实现搜索功能需通过用户输入构建数据库查询,核心是使用LIKE或全文索引进行模糊匹配,并结合预处理语句防止SQL注入。首先创建HTML表单提交关键词,后端用PDO连接数据库并执行参数化查询,确保安全性;接着在显示结果时使用htmlspecialchars避免XSS攻击。为提升性能,应为搜索字段建立索引,优先采用全文索引(FULLTEXT)和MATCHAGAINST替代LIKE以提高查询效率,同时引入分页(LIMIT/OFFSET)减少负载。还可通过Redis缓存热门搜索结果降低数据库压力。安
- 每日编程 1087 2025-09-17 23:50:01
-
- HTML在线运行代码导出_将HTML在线运行代码导出为本地文件
- 首先检查服务器IP地址解析问题,再通过浏览器开发者工具保存HTML源码,或使用JavaScript脚本动态导出页面内容,也可利用JSFiddle等平台的导出功能获取完整文件。
- 每日编程 1128 2025-09-17 23:47:01
-
- PHP代码注入检测流量分析_PHP代码注入流量特征分析方法
- 答案:PHP代码注入流量特征包括含敏感函数的参数、异常编码载荷、非常规参数名、服务器响应泄露等,需结合WAF、IDS、SIEM和抓包工具进行综合分析,但受限于HTTPS加密、混淆绕过、误报漏报及高流量处理难度。
- 每日编程 929 2025-09-17 23:46:01
-
- HTML打印样式怎么优化_打印版本可访问性设计指南
- 答案:优化HTML打印样式需使用@mediaprint规则,移除非核心元素,重置布局与边距,设置高对比度字体颜色,调整字号行高,显示链接URL,避免分页截断重要内容,提升可访问性。
- 每日编程 319 2025-09-17 23:38:01
-
- HTML侧边栏怎么创建_HTML的aside标签创建侧边栏
- 使用标签创建HTML侧边栏,结合CSSFlexbox或position:fixed实现布局与固定定位,通过JavaScript动态更新内容,确保语义化结构。
- 每日编程 999 2025-09-17 23:37:01
-
- HTML拖拽API与交互界面前端设计_HTML拖拽API与交互界面前端设计指南详解
- 要实现网页元素拖拽功能,需设置draggable="true"属性并监听dragstart、dragover、drop等事件,通过DataTransfer对象传递数据,结合event.preventDefault()允许放置,并可自定义拖拽样式与图像以提升交互体验。
- 每日编程 705 2025-09-17 23:33:01
-
- 如何用css实现多行文本溢出省略
- 使用-webkit-line-clamp可实现多行文本溢出省略,需配合display:-webkit-box、-webkit-box-orient:vertical、overflow:hidden和text-overflow:ellipsis使用,适用于现代主流浏览器,但不支持IE及部分老版本浏览器,Firefox需JavaScript辅助,建议固定line-height以保证截断一致性。
- 每日编程 833 2025-09-17 23:32:01
-
- HTML文档语言怎么设置_HTML语言属性设置方法
- 设置HTML文档语言需在标签添加lang属性,如lang="zh-CN"表示简体中文;2.此设置提升SEO,帮助搜索引擎准确识别内容语言;3.有助于辅助技术正确朗读,改善用户体验;4.多语言页面可在特定元素上设置lang属性以覆盖根语言,确保各语言片段被正确处理。
- 每日编程 436 2025-09-17 23:29:01
-
- HTML时间怎么标记_HTML的time标签标记时间教程
- 标签用于语义化标记时间,提升可访问性与SEO;2.通过datetime属性提供ISO8601标准的机器可读时间;3.可与、、等标签结合使用,增强结构语义。
- 每日编程 739 2025-09-17 23:28:01
-
- 在移动端项目中优化css引入方式
- 优化移动端CSS引入需减少HTTP请求、内联关键CSS、设置缓存、按需加载。合并文件、异步加载非关键CSS、压缩代码并避免冗余框架,结合Lighthouse与DevTools监控FCP、LCP等指标,持续优化性能。
- 每日编程 1050 2025-09-17 23:28:01
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

